Classic Desi Breakfast Spots

Rich Tradition and Bold Flavors

Karachi’s traditional breakfast places are where you can enjoy deeply flavorful classics that have roots in local culture. These places often serve dishes that are associated with comfort, nostalgia, and hearty satisfaction.

Tooso – A Legendary Nashta Place

One of the most talked-about places when it comes to classic breakfast is Tooso – Since 1976. This restaurant has been serving breakfast in Karachi for decades and is famous for its halwa puri, aloo bhujia, lassi, and freshly made eggs. The generous plates and welcoming vibe make it a favorite for many locals.

Boat Basin Food Street – Multiple Options

At Boat Basin, you’ll find a whole area dedicated to food, with several little breakfast spots and dhabas offering everything from puris to parathas and chai. It’s a great place for large groups and families who want variety and liveliness in their morning meal.

Quetta Alamgir Hotel – Authentic Street Breakfast

For a truly local, straightforward breakfast experience, Quetta Alamgir Hotel main branch 1 is known for crunchy parathas and strong doodh pati chai. Many Karachites swear by the breakfast here, especially if you want strong flavors and affordable prices.

Breakfast Corner – Budget-Friendly Hero

If you’re looking for authentic desi breakfast without spending much, Breakfast Corner offers ese classic Pakistani breakfast items with great taste and value. It’s one of the smaller places but beloved by locals for its simple goodness.


Trendy Cafés: Continental and Modern Breakfast

Karachi’s café culture has grown quickly, and many places offer upscale, international breakfast menus — perfect for brunch dates or late mornings with friends.

Xander’s – Consistently Popular

One of the most celebrated Top restaurant in Karachi for breakfast and brunch is Xander's (with a branch also in Clifton Xander's Clifton). Known for its international-style breakfast, Xander’s offers everything from eggs benedict to gourmet avocado toast and pancakes. The welcoming atmosphere, combined with high-quality ingredients, makes it a go-to place for many Karachi foodies.

Springs Café – Cozy and Delicious

Another excellent choice is Springs Cafe, a café loved for its laid-back vibes and tasty breakfast options. Customers often recommend their pancake stacks, fresh juices, and breakfast sandwiches. This café is especially great if you want a relaxed, enjoyable morning with friends or family.

Butlers Chocolate Café – Sweet and Savory Mix

For those with a sweet tooth, Butlers Chocolate Café in Zamzama is a perfect choice. While known for desserts, their breakfast menu is also highly rated, featuring classic items like French toast, waffles, and delicious omelets paired with rich coffee or hot chocolate.

E Street Mews Café – Stylish and Comfortable

A charming place in Clifton, E Street Mews Cafe is known for continental and fusion breakfast options. From fluffy eggs to fresh pastries and specialty coffee, this café offers a lovely spot for a long morning meal. The ambiance is a big part of its charm, making it ideal for slow weekend brunches.


More Great Breakfast Spots Worth Trying

Cafe Chatterbox – Classic and Cozy

Cafe Chatterbox in DHA is known for a laid-back atmosphere and delicious breakfast platters. The variety on the menu, including eggs, pancakes, and sandwiches, makes it a versatile choice for different tastes.

Nadia Café – Elegant Breakfast in Civil Lines

If you’re seeking something slightly more refined, Nadia Cafe inside the Marriott area offers a delightful mix of continental and local breakfast items with a classic café vibe.

Evergreen Café – Healthy and Fresh

For wholesome breakfast options, Evergreen Cafe is a great pick. They focus on fresh ingredients and creative breakfast dishes that make you feel good without compromising taste.

Bella Vita – Stylish Breakfast Option

Bella Vita – Tipu Sultan has a stylish menu with many breakfast and brunch choices, perfect for those who want a mix of classic and trendy dishes.


Tips for Choosing Your Perfect Breakfast Spot

Choosing the right breakfast spot depends on a few factors:

  1. Mood & Style – Do you want traditional Pakistani flavours or a continental breakfast? Places like Tooso and Boat Basin serve hearty desi breakfasts, while Xander’s and Butlers offer more continental dishes.

  2. Occasion – For family outings, traditional spots and larger cafes work well. For date mornings or meetings, stylish cafés like E Street Mews or Nadia Café fit better.

  3. Budget – Street breakfast and local dhabas are budget-friendly. Cafés and upscale restaurants tend to be pricier but offer a wider variety and refined experience.

  4. Time – Some spots open early for quick weekday breakfasts, while others are best for relaxed weekend brunches.
